Crown Molding - Lowe's    $55
Beadboard - Lowe's          $90
Mirror - Walmart             $22
Light Fixture - Lowe's      $50
Artwork - Home Goods    $30
Faucet - Overstock          $55
Shower Curtain - Lowe's  $20

Total Cost for Project     $317

Here is the new view of our bathroom ceiling instead of the boring plain ceiling that existed before it.

These are other images from the bathroom. We kept the original countertop for now, and when the budget allows we hope to replace that and get a new toilet. We also kept the originial tile floor.
